2026 Trail Beautification Days on the ERT

May 22 2026

9:00 a.m. - 11:00 a.m.
Elizabeth River Trail TBD, Price: Free

On the fourth Friday in the months of March to November, volunteers can join the Master Gardeners to help beautify the trail and learn more about the native plant species found along the trail!
– All skill levels welcome!
– Bring your own weeding tools and graden gloves if you can!
– Support the Trail
– Meet new people
– Learn about plants and plant care with local experts!

 

HOW TO PREPARE:
– Bring water. Some snacks and water will be available
– Dress comfortably and appropriately for the weather and working outside among the plants. Long pants (versus shorts) are highly recommended.
– Bring sun protection and bug spray if needed
QUESTIONS?
Contact hello@elizabethrivertrail.org if:
– You have questions or concerns about the location and/or work being done.
– You would like to register. This isn’t required, but it is helpful!
– You have a group that would like to join, but would need assistance with gardening tools/gloves.
– You would like to join the ERT Green Team and do beautification work on the Trail when it is convenient for you.
LOCATIONS:
Locations will be announced during the week before the event in the Trail Beautification Day Facebook event page discussion. Locations we rotate between include:
– Plum Point Park (ERT- Fort Norfolk section)
– ERT Fitness Course (ERT – Fort Norfolk section)
– ERT Managed Meadow (ERT – Chelsea section)
– ERT Donor Sculpture by the Pagoda (ERT – Freemason section)
– MicroFarm in Lambert’s Point (ERT – Lambert’s Point section)
– NEW ERT Trailside Headquarters (ERT – Chelsea section)

An Evening with Jocelyn Gould at Attucks Theatre

May 1 2026

9:00 a.m. - 11:00 a.m.
Attucks Theatre 1010 Church Street Norfolk, VA 23510, Price:

JUNO Award-winning guitarist Jocelyn Gould “has quickly become an international favorite with her hard swinging, imaginative approach and technical mastery” (Joe Lang, Jersey Jazz Magazine). Her joyful energy has captivated music fans around the world, and her passion for music is as infectious as her unique ability to connect with audiences. Jocelyn has absorbed the influences of the jazz guitar greats and has woven them into an exciting personal sound, citing Wes Montgomery, Grant Green, Joe Pass, and Kenny Burrell as primary influences on the guitar.

 

Jocelyn’s debut album, Elegant Traveler, won the 2021 JUNO Award for Jazz Album of the Year: Solo. Her albums Sonic Bouquet and Portrait Of Right Now were nominated for the 2024 and 2025 JUNO Awards for Jazz Album of the Year: Solo.

 

2025 saw Jocelyn tour full-time as a leader and supporting musician throughout Europe, North America, and Japan, playing in venues such as Massey Hall in Toronto, Birdland and Dizzy’s Club Coca-Cola in New York City, the Montreal Jazz Festival, Pizza Express SOHO in London, UK, Le Duc Des Lombards in Paris, and Jazzhus Montmartre in Copenhagen. She released a solo guitar-and-voice album in the fall of 2025, her 5th as a leader. In 2026, Jocelyn will continue touring internationally and release her 6th album.

 

Jocelyn has performed and recorded as a supporting musician with GRAMMY-nominated vocalist Freddy Cole, JUNO-winning trumpeter and vocalist Bria Skonberg, DownBeat Trombonist of the Year Michael Dease, Etienne Charles, Caity Gyorgy, Benny Bennack III, Jon Gordon, Rodney Whitaker, Will Bonness, Randy Napoleon, Diego Rivera, and many more.

 

Jocelyn is an experienced educator and was a full time professor and the Head of Guitar Department at Humber College in Toronto from 2019-2024. She is the guitar faculty at the Brevard Jazz Institute in North Carolina and the Seiko Summer Jazz Camp in Tokyo, Japan. She has been a guest artist at the Jazz Institute Berlin, the Leeds Conservatory of Music, the San Francisco Conservatory of Music, Michigan State University, the University of South Carolina, North Eastern State University, Ohio University, the University of North Carolina, Broward University, and others.

 

Jocelyn Gould is managed by Birdland Artists and is a Benedetto-endorsed artist.
